The route to the main entrance

  • The route to the entrance is smooth and sufficiently wide and illuminated.
  • There is a steep slope on the passage.
  • The passage has at least 4 turning steps with handrails on one side.

The main entrance

  • The entrance is located in a recess and is illuminated.
  • The doors connected to the entrance stand out clearly. Outside the door there is sufficient room for moving e.g. with a wheelchair. The door opens easily manually.
  • The entrance has thresholds over 2 cm high.

In the facility

  • The customer service point has two floors.
  • For moving around, there is a lift, which can hold a wheelchair; the door opens automatically. The floor numbers in the lift can be felt with fingers. (The minimum dimensions for an accessible lift are width 1.1 m and depth 1.4 m.)
  • The doors in the facility are hard to perceive.
  • The facility has a toilet marked as accessible on floor 1. The toilet does not have sufficient room for a wheelchair and the door is too narrow. One or both sides of the toilet seat lack a support rail.
